Accessing Codes

Good day,

I have a customer with two new Doosan GC55C-9. Both trucks have mil lights on. I was hoping someone could assist with accessing codes. I do have a kubota cable with a generic scanner but unfortunately won't communicate with this truck. Is there a way on these new trucks to get the mil to flash codes?

What engine is in these lifts? You can use a generic obd scanner with the GCT/ Nissan engine but you will have to have a laptop to access a Hyundai
